1 proposition /ˌprɑːpəˈzɪʃən/ noun plural propositions
plural propositions
Learner's definition of PROPOSITION
[count]
1
: something (such as a plan or offer) that is presented to a person or group of people to consider提議;建議 2
: a statement to be proved, explained, or discussed(有待證明、說明或討論的)說法,觀點,命題 -
Her theory rejects the basic proposition that humans evolved from apes.她的理論否定了人類由類人猿進化而來的基本觀點。
-
If we accept proposition “A” as true, then we must accept proposition “B” as false.如果承認命題A爲正確的,那麽就必須承認命題B是錯誤的。
3
: something that someone intends to do or deal with欲處理的事 -
Fixing the engine will not be an easy/simple proposition. [=matter]修理引擎不是件容易的事。
-
The election will be a tough proposition for the mayor.這次選舉對市長來說有些困難。
-
The farm will never be a paying proposition. [=the farm will never make money]這家農場永遠不會赢利。
4
US : a suggestion for a change in the law on which people must vote(美國)法律修正議案 2 proposition /ˌprɑːpəˈzɪʃən/ verb
